    I think the Rockets have been pretty open about what they expect out of him. A guy who'll play well in the pick-and-pop game. A player who can run down the floor in transition and get good open shots in early offense. A player who can play effectively in the high post. Not a strong rebounder or defender, but a player who's smart and can pick up team defensive concepts in time.

    I didn't like what I saw from Andersen in his first game, but the above possibilities have not been ruled out. It can take a long while for international players to adjust to the NBA. Scola, if you recall, was terrible early on his rookie season.
